Entrance Preview

I took IIT JEE, BIT SAT, AIEEE and MHT CET. I secured 15287 AIR in IIT JEE 2011, 192 marks in AIEEE, 190 marks in BITSAT and 167 marks in MHT CET. I got admission in COEP through MHT CET. COEP is one of the oldest college in Asia. It was established in 18th century. It is an Autonomous government institute. It comes uner top 20 engineering colleges in India. As I was getting my preferred branck at COEP I opted for it.

Course Curriculum Overview

5

The total course was of four years which is subdivided in semesters there are two semesters in each year as my particular branch was having sandwich pattern we had 1 year industrial implant training which was supposed to be completed in 2 semesters of 6 months each.

Internships Opportunities

As per our curriculum we were having one year industrial internship (particularly for Production Sandwich). I did my internship at Tata Motors, Pune. Wherein I got much helpful knowledge of automotive industry and I successfully completed my project on Logistics. Many more companies like Mercedes, Volks wagon, Forbes Marshall, Thermax, JCB, Loreal, TCS came for the internships i got stipend of 5000/- per month average stipend was around 6k to 7k.

Placement Experience

5

Placements at COEP are outstanding. At the end of the final year around 90% students get placed from their respective branches. Till date more than 300 students are placed. More than 200 companies have visited the college. I got placed in Tata Motors, Pune and got package of 6.15 lpa highest package till now it 18 lpa. Major comapnies visited are De Shaw (18 lpa), Barclays (8lpa), Tata motors (6.15 lpa), Citibank (12 lpa), General motors ( 8 lpa), mercedes ( 6 lpa), Fiat (4.25 lpa), TCS ( 3.33 lpa), Bajaj ( 7.2 lpa) , Whirlpool(6 lpa) etc.

College Events

5

There are around 20 clubs in th COEP. The major events in the college are Mind Spark, ZEST, Regatta, Annual gathering, Spanadan, Baja, Supra etc mind spark is a national level techinal event held in COEP. Many students all across the country come and participate in the more than 50 events in Mind Spark. It is considered as second biggest technical event in India after techfest IIT Bombay. Zest is a intercollege spoerts event. Regatta is a boat club event which has been organised by COEP for last 85 years. It consists of Kayaking, Rowing, punt formation, Mashaal Dance. Also many cultural events like annual gathering, mad ads social events like spandan (blood donation camp) are held at COEP.

Fee Structure And Facilities

Being an autonomous government institution, COEP has a feasible fee structure tuition fee for the college is around 62000 for general category student and much lesser for backward category students.

Fees and Financial Aid

There are many good scholarships which are provided in the college one of which is Vinod Doshi scholarship for needy students which covers all the expenses from hostel and mess fees to college fees also those who seek to do internships abroad can apply for charpak also many scholarships are available for backward class students.

Campus Life

4.5

Overall campus life is excellent gender ration is well maintained as there are many clubs there is lot of scope for students to participate in extracurricular activities. There is English as well as marathi debate club in the college technical clubs like Robot study circle, Team nemesis ( for BAJA), Team octane racing ( for Supra) are there in the college. College has been on the pole position in BAJA and Supra national events. College environment is quite safe so students don't have to tolerate activities like ragging, racism or other activires related to gender, religion, economic status etc.

Hostel Facilities

4.5

Hostel and mess food at COEP is excellent there are 8 hostel blocks for male students and 3 hostel blocks for girls. Hostel accommodation is on the basis of merit average rentals if you don't get a hostel is 3000/- per month in hostel 4 students share single room all the basic amenities like drinking water, 24 hours tap water and electricity, hot water, Wifi and lan, Canteen and mess, room cleaning are provided in the hostel rooms are properly ventilated. Hostel fees are 20,000/- per year.

Exam Structure

Students has to go through 3 exams per semesters. There are 2 unit tests of 20 marks each and one end semester exam of 60 marks. They add up to total of 100 marks. COEP follows CGPA grading system and pointers are given on the scale of 10. There is a gap of around 1.5 months within all three exams. There are around 3 to 4 labs per week the schedule varies according to branch and day of the week generally it is from 9am to 4pm saturday and Sundays are holidays.
